LEMF?RDER 25605 02 Engine Mounting

LEMF?RDER 25605 02 Engine Mounting

Post Buying Request Connecting Buyers Width China Suppliers

OEM

  • MERCEDES-BENZ941 241 76 13
  • MERCEDES-BENZA 941 241 76 13

Similar Products

02881

Metalcaucho 02881 Engine Mounting

10450 01

LEMF?RDER 10450 01 Engine Mounting

TM-ZZE150LH

FEBEST TM-ZZE150LH Engine Mounting

368653

TRICLO 368653 Engine Mounting

ME-2298

LYNXauto ME-2298 Engine Mounting

49361587

CORTECO 49361587 Engine Mounting

514304

GSP 514304 Engine Mounting

12377

FARE SA 12377 Engine Mounting

80004470

CORTECO 80004470 Engine Mounting

T405194

STC T405194 Engine Mounting

4317901189

JP GROUP 4317901189 Engine Mounting

SM2080

DüRER SM2080 Engine Mounting